Zero‑Wager Free Spins: The Casino’s Way of Giving You Nothing for Nothing

Zero‑Wager Free Spins: The Casino’s Way of Giving You Nothing for Nothing

There’s nothing more delightful than a promotion that promises “free” spins, yet you end up staring at a spreadsheet of constraints that would make a tax accountant weep. The term “no wagering slots free spins” has become the industry’s favourite buzzword, a shiny badge slapped on a banner to lure the gullible. In practice it’s a thinly veiled cash‑grab, a way for operators to look generous while they keep the ledger balanced.

Why “No Wagering” Is Only a Marketing Illusion

First, let’s dismantle the myth. No wagering doesn’t mean you can cash out the winnings without a fight. It simply means the casino has removed the traditional 30x‑40x play‑through requirement. That still leaves you with a profit cap, a minimum turnover, or a stipulation that the free spins must be used on a designated list of games. It’s the same as handing a child a lollipop at the dentist – you get a taste, but the price of the filling remains.

Take Betfair’s sister site Betway. They’ll hand you a batch of “no wagering” spins on Starburst, but only if you consent to a 20‑second delay before each spin, a mechanic designed to nudge you into the “I’m in a rush” panic button. The result? You’re forced to play faster than you’d naturally choose, and the odds of hitting a high‑value scatter drop dramatically.

And then there’s 888casino, which pairs its free spins with a strict maximum win limit of £25. It’s a clever way to say “you’re lucky, but not enough to matter.” You could be thrilled to see a cascade of Gonzo’s Quest symbols line up, only to watch the payout clamp at the pre‑set ceiling. The excitement is short‑lived, much like a cigarette break in a rainstorm.

Even the supposedly “premium” William Hill cannot escape this pattern. Their “no wagering” spins come with a hidden condition: you must place a minimum bet of £0.10 on each spin. For a player accustomed to low‑budget gameplay, that transforms a free spin into a forced gamble, eroding the illusion of a genuine gift.

How the Mechanics Stack Up Against Real Slots

Comparing the mechanics of “no wagering” spins to the dynamics of popular slots highlights the absurdity. Starburst, for example, is renowned for its rapid, low‑variance spins – you spin, you win a little, you spin again. That brisk rhythm mirrors the casino’s desire to churn out spins quickly, squeezing value from the player before they can even consider the odds.

Contrast that with Gonzo’s Quest’s avalanche feature, which can produce high volatility payouts. The free spin scheme rarely allows you to engage such volatility fully; the caps and game restrictions keep you anchored to low‑risk outcomes, effectively flattening the thrill of a true high‑roller experience.

Even when a free spin lands on a high‑paying symbol, the casino’s algorithm will often downgrade the payout to fit within the pre‑agreed limits. It’s as if the machine itself is self‑censoring, aware that any real profit would betray the pretense of generosity.

Typical Pitfalls of “No Wagering” Offers

  • Profit caps that render wins meaningless – often £10‑£30.
  • Mandatory bet sizes that turn a “free” spin into a forced wager.
  • Restricted game lists, pushing players onto low‑margin titles.
  • Short expiry windows, forcing hurried play and inevitable mistakes.
  • Hidden turnover requirements masquerading as “no wagering”.

These pitfalls are not random; they’re engineered to keep the house edge comfortably high while the marketing department shouts “free.” The average player, dazzled by the word “free,” neglects to read the fine print, which is where the casino secures its profit.

Now, you might think that the sheer volume of free spins compensates for the constraints. That’s a naïve calculation. If you receive 100 spins with a £0.10 bet each, the maximum theoretical loss is £10 – a number that looks small until you consider that the average return‑to‑player (RTP) on the listed games hovers around 95%. You’re still expected to lose about £0.50 in total, but the casino has already collected your data and, potentially, your future deposits.

On the other hand, if those 100 spins were unrestricted, you could wager higher amounts on high‑variance games, potentially turning a modest win into a respectable sum. The “no wagering” label strips away that possibility, corralling you into a sandbox where every move is pre‑approved by the operator.

And we haven’t even touched on the psychological aspect. The phrase “no wagering” triggers a dopamine hit – you feel you’ve outsmarted the system. The casino, however, knows that the brain’s reward centre can be hijacked with the promise of something for nothing, even if the actual reward is minuscule. It’s a classic case of “you get what you pay for,” except the payment is disguised as “no cost.”

There’s also the matter of “gift” terminology. Casinos love to parade the word “gift” across their banners, making it sound like a charitable act. Let’s be clear: nobody’s handing out “free” money for the sake of goodwill. It’s a transaction dressed up as generosity, a thin veneer over a profit‑driven model.

In practice, the only people who truly benefit from these offers are the operators, who collect player data, encourage deposits, and keep the churn high. The rest of us are left with a handful of spins that feel like a polite nod rather than a substantial advantage.
